Description

Memorandum between Mr McLean, Port Sunlight and Mr L.V. Fildes, Lever House discussing C.F.R. Knowles confirming that he has written to the Trustees of the Co-Partnership Trust requesting permission to seek other employment. 27 October 1926 and 29 October 1926 [For related correspondence, see catalogue entries GB1752.LBC/136/94, GB1752.LBC/136/100, GB1752.LBC/136/101, GB1752.LBC/136/105, GB1752.LBC/136/107, GB1752.LBC/136/108 and GB1752.LBC/136/109]
